Interesting Facts About the Jeep Grand Cherokee ZJ
The Jeep Grand Cherokee ZJ launched its first model year in 1993 and ran through the 1998 model year. This first‑generation SUV blended Jeep's legendary off‑road capability with everyday practicality, setting the stage for future Cherokee successors.

Birth of a New SUV (1993 Debut)
The Grand Cherokee's first production model year was 1993, although its origins date back to 1983 when AMC, Jeep's parent company at the time, began development. The ZJ marked Jeep's entry into the midsize SUV segment.
Production Span and Transition
Production of the first‑generation Jeep Grand Cherokee ZJ ended in mid‑1998, at which point the next generation (WJ) began production at Jefferson. The ZJ therefore covered model years 1993 through 1998.
Strategic Replacement of Older Models
The 1993‑1998 ZJ generation was initially slated to replace both the SJ Jeep Wagoneer and other legacy Jeep models, consolidating Jeep's SUV lineup into a single, modern platform.
